Myths About LASIK Discomfort
As opposed to common belief, LASIK surgical procedure isn't as agonizing as many people assume. The treatment itself is reasonably fast and pain-free. You may feel some stress or pain during the surgical procedure, but it's normally minimal. The specialist will make use of numbing eye goes down to ensure that you don't feel any kind of pain throughout the procedure.
While it's normal to experience some dryness, irritation, or mild pain in the hours following the surgical procedure, this can usually be taken care of with over-the-counter pain medication and eye declines. It is necessary to follow your physician's post-operative treatment guidelines to decrease any type of discomfort and promote appropriate healing.
Keep in mind that everybody's discomfort resistance is different, so what someone might call unpleasant might be completely bearable for one more. Feel confident that LASIK discomfort is generally not a major concern and should not discourage you from considering this life-altering procedure.
Dangers Associated With LASIK
Lots of people undergoing LASIK surgical treatment are mainly concerned concerning prospective risks associated with the treatment. While LASIK is a secure and effective therapy for vision Correction, like any operation, it does come with some threats.
One of the most typical threats connected with LASIK include completely dry eyes, glare, halos, and problem driving at night in the immediate postoperative duration. These signs are typically short-lived and improve as the eyes recover.
In Laser LASIK Surgery , even more serious issues such as infection, corneal flap concerns, and vision loss can take place, but the chance of these problems is exceptionally low when the surgical procedure is done by a skilled and experienced ophthalmologist. It is necessary to discuss these dangers with your doctor during the assessment to ensure you have a clear understanding of what to anticipate.

LASIK qualification is determined through a comprehensive eye exam by a qualified ophthalmologist. Factors such as corneal density, eye health, and total medical history play a critical function in assessing a client's suitability for the surgical treatment.
Also individuals over 40, who might have presbyopia (age-related problem concentrating on close things), can potentially undertake LASIK or other vision Correction procedures.
It is essential not to self-diagnose your eligibility for LASIK surgical procedure. Consulting with a seasoned eye treatment expert is the most effective means to establish if you're a suitable prospect for this life-changing treatment.
